Complete Buying Guide for Best Fertilizer For Outdoor Flowers
Essential Factors We Consider
When selecting the best fertilizer for outdoor flowers, we evaluate several key factors: NPK ratio (nitrogen, phosphorus, potassium), organic vs. synthetic composition, release type (slow or fast), ease of application, and plant compatibility. For blooming plants, we prioritize higher phosphorus levels (the middle number) to support flower development. We also consider safety for pets and children, environmental impact, and value for money.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How often should I fertilize outdoor flowers?
A: Most flowering plants benefit from feeding every 4–6 weeks during the growing season. Water-soluble fertilizers like Miracle-Gro may require weekly applications, while slow-release organic options can last up to 8 weeks.
Q: Can I use lawn fertilizer on flower beds?
A: It’s not recommended unless the product is labeled for flowers. Lawn fertilizers are often high in nitrogen, which promotes leafy growth at the expense of blooms. Use a bloom booster with higher phosphorus instead.
Q: Are organic fertilizers safer for pets?
A: Yes, most organic fertilizers like Dr. Earth and Sovata are non-toxic and safe once applied. Always check the label, but generally, they pose far less risk than synthetic alternatives.
Q: Will fertilizer help my flowers bloom more?
A: Absolutely—especially if your soil lacks key nutrients. A balanced fertilizer with adequate phosphorus directly supports bud formation and vibrant blooms.
Q: Can I mix different fertilizers?
A: It’s best to avoid mixing unless specified by the manufacturer. Overlapping nutrients can lead to salt buildup or nutrient burn. Stick to one trusted product per growing cycle.
